Job Description:

Position Function:

Reporting to the Associate Athletic Director for Principal Giving, the position’s primary focus is to develop and execute short and long-range strategies that identify, cultivate, solicit, and steward prospects capable of making major gifts to Mississippi State Athletics. This position will closely collaborate with Athletics Development team members and other staff members from across the department to ensure good communication and synergy of operations leading to maximum results. The successful candidate will be highly collaborative, committed to a culture of excellence, demonstrate advanced fundraising competencies, and help sustain MSU Athletics’ fundraising success and growth through their leadership.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

1. Assist in implementation of programs for fund-raising for Mississippi State Athletics, to generate private contributions in support of the efforts of its student-athletes, coaches, and administrators.
2. Ensure compliance with NCAA rules and regulations regarding outside interest groups, to include informing alumni and "booster" groups about applicable rules that could affect the operation of the intercollegiate athletics program.
3. Identify, cultivate, and solicit individual prospects in coordination with faculty, staff, and volunteers through the proper clearance process.
4. Manage an active portfolio of 250-300 prospects and oversee fundraising in assigned areas.
5. Maintain substantive contact reports
6. Coordinate special fundraising projects as assigned by the Associate AD for Principal Giving, the Deputy AD or the AD. (i.e. facility enhancement projects, foreign trips, etc.)
7. Assist with the coordination/planning of the MSU Major Giving society.
8. Serve as the fundraising contact for assigned sports.
9. Perform other duties as assigned by the Associate Athletic Director for Principal Giving and Team Lead.
10. Directly reports to the Associate AD of Principal Giving.

Minimum Qualifications:

Bachelor's degree in Business, Public Relations or related field with 3 years of experience in related field.

Preferred Qualifications:

Master's Degree with direct experience in fund-raising or advancement in a higher education setting, preferably in educational fund-raising.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:

1. Excellent oral and written communication skills.
2. Excellent interpersonal skills and the ability to work effectively with university officials, faculty, prominent alumni and friends of Business, i.e., multiple and varied constituencies.
3. Basic computer skills.
4. Ability to meet significant travel requirements of position.
